Opposing ViewpointsGale In Context: Opposing Viewpoints, is a free online database covering today’s hottest social issues. This cross-curricular digital resource provides informed, differing views to help learners develop critical-thinking skills and draw their own conclusions.

Gale In Context: Opposing Viewpoints is a rich resource for debaters and includes pro/con viewpoints, reference articles, interactive maps, infographics, and more. A category on the National Debate Topic provides quick and easy access to content on frequently studied and discussed issues. Periodical content covers current events, news and commentary, economics, environmental issues, political science and more.

Additionally, users can download a Chrome extension that makes it easier for users to find and access content from Gale In Context: Opposing Viewpoints through their library from a Google search, creating a simple and direct path to authoritative digital resources. Once configured to Chrome browsers, the extension will display results directly from the library’s Gale In Context: Opposing Viewpoints database, alongside Google search results.

Gale In Context: Opposing Viewpoints includes:

  • 20,100+ pro/con viewpoints
  • 19,200+ reference articles, including topic overviews
  • 12,700+ charts and graphs, along with other statistical information
  • 300+ profiles of federal agencies and special-interest groups
  • Special coverage of the annual debate topic determined by the National Speech and Debate Association
  • Full-text newspapers and periodicals from multiple perspectives, including: The New York Times, Newsweek, Foreign Policy, American Scientist and Education Week and more.
